Definitely worth it- we get an extra grand back on the new X5, 10-15% discount on parts and their magazine (Roundel) is the best club magazine out there. Membership has paid for itself many times over.
I'm a member of the Porsche club too and their magazine (Panorama) doesn't even come close. However, the Porsche club events do blow away BMW's- our own local chapter does six to eight DEs a year at places ranging from Mid-Ohio to Watkins Glen, plus lots of autox and social events. The local BMW club does two DEs- one of which is at a 1.1 mile training circuit. Not many autox and even fewer social. |
